Many people assume that you need to spend a fortune to get a solid 8-core processor, but the AMD Ryzen 7 9700X shatters that myth. I was surprised at how much power you get for just over three hundred bucks.

Right out of the box, it feels like a premium part, with a sturdy build and a sleek design. The 5.5 GHz max boost is no joke, especially when you’re gaming or doing intensive tasks.

I pushed it through some of the latest titles, and it delivered over 100 FPS consistently.

Handling multitasking? No problem.

With 16 threads, it smoothly manages streaming, gaming, and even some content creation. The support for DDR5-5600 and PCIe 5.0 makes it future-proof, and I could see this being a great upgrade for someone on a budget but wanting to stay current.

Overclocking was straightforward, thanks to its unlocked design. Temperatures stayed reasonable with a decent aftermarket cooler, but keep in mind, the cooler isn’t bundled.

Overall, it’s a fantastic choice if you want a balance of performance and price, especially for gaming or everyday use.

One thing to note: it’s based on AMD’s “Zen 5” architecture, which means you’ll need an AM5 socket motherboard. If you’re upgrading, make sure your system is compatible.

Still, for the price, this chip offers incredible value and performance.

Clock Speed: The clock speed, measured in GHz, indicates how many cycles per second the processor can perform. A higher clock speed generally results in better single-threaded performance, which is beneficial for applications that do not utilize multiple cores effectively, ensuring a smoother experience in everyday tasks and gaming.

Thermal Design Power (TDP): TDP refers to the maximum amount of heat generated by the processor that the cooling system must dissipate under normal operating conditions. Lower TDP values typically mean less energy consumption and heat production, leading to quieter operation and less need for robust cooling solutions, which is especially advantageous in budget builds.

What Should You Consider When Choosing a Budget 8 Core Processor?

When choosing the best budget 8 core processor, several key factors should be considered to ensure optimal performance and value for money.

  • Performance: Assess the processor’s clock speed and architecture, as these determine the overall performance capabilities. Higher clock speeds generally lead to better performance, but the efficiency of the architecture is equally important, with newer designs offering improved performance per watt.
  • Compatibility: Ensure that the processor is compatible with your motherboard and other components. Check the socket type and chipset specifications to avoid any compatibility issues which can lead to additional costs for upgrades.
  • Thermal Design Power (TDP): Consider the TDP rating, which indicates the amount of heat generated by the processor under load. A lower TDP means less heat, which can translate to quieter operation and reduced cooling requirements, making it ideal for budget builds where cooling solutions may be limited.
  • Integrated Graphics: Evaluate whether the processor has integrated graphics, which can be beneficial if you are not planning to purchase a separate graphics card. Integrated graphics can handle basic tasks and light gaming, saving additional costs in a budget setup.
  • Price-to-Performance Ratio: Look for processors that offer the best performance for their price point. Benchmarking and reviews can provide insights into how well a processor performs relative to its cost, helping you make an informed decision.
  • Future-Proofing: Consider how long the processor will meet your needs. Investing in a slightly more powerful processor might be worthwhile if it ensures compatibility with future software and applications, potentially extending the lifespan of your build.
  • Brand and Warranty: Look at reputable brands that offer good customer support and warranty options. A reliable brand can provide peace of mind, and a solid warranty can protect your investment in case of defects or issues.
